首頁 > 軟體

Rust語言中的String和HashMap使用範例詳解

2022-10-20 14:03:06

String

字串是比很多開發者所理解的更為複雜的資料結構。加上 UTF-8 的不定長編碼等原因,Rust 中的字串並不如其它語言中那麼好理解。

Rust 的核心語言中只有一種字串型別:str。字串 slice,它通常以被借用的形式出現:&str 是一些儲存在別處的 UTF-8 編碼字串資料的參照。而 String 的型別是由標準庫提供的,而沒有寫進核心語言部分,它是可增長的、可變的、有所有權的、UTF-8 編碼的字串型別。


IT145.com E-mail:sddin#qq.com